do

noun

Definition of DO

1
a social gathering <it's supposed to be some sort of fancy do>
2
a statement of what to do that must be obeyed by those concerned <issued a long list of dos and don'ts before we even started the project>
3
a style or arrangement of hair <you can tell that the picture was taken in the 1980s from my permed do>
chiefly dialect
a state of noisy, confused activity <in that small town a great deal of do could come from very little indeed>
Near Antonyms calm, hush, peace, quiet, quietude, rest, stillness, tranquillity (or tranquility); order, orderliness
